<p>The NITI Aayog’s health index report for 2019-20, like its previous editions, ranks all states on a weighted composite score and gives a useful picture of the relative state of health and healthcare across the country. The score is based on 24 indicators and covers three broad domains —health outcomes, governance, and information. </p>.<p><a href="https://www.deccanherald.com/opinion/second-edit/health-index-visible-north-south-divide-1068632.html"><strong>Read More</strong></a></p>
